Mayday for Mandate Relief
Mayday is an international call for help, and Mayday for Mandate Relief calls on the State to provide much-needed help to counties through mandate relief measures.
During the month of May, county leaders and taxpayers across the state will hold the spotlight on the State mandated programs that continue to consume property tax dollars and curtail critical local services that contribute to New York State’s excellent quality of life.
The Governor’s Mandate Relief Council is charged with reviewing specific mandates identified by local governments, and advancing proposals to reduce the burden on counties, cities, and towns. Mayday for Mandate Relief events will call on this Council to submit a package of relief proposals to the Governor and State Legislature for a vote this State Legislative Session.
Through Mayday for Mandate Relief, counties urge the Council: “No more waiting; the time for relief is now.”
